What is the cheapest month to fly from Orlando Airport to Vermont?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Orlando Airport to Vermont,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Orlando Airport to Vermont is January, when tickets cost $153 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and October,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$492 and $373 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Orlando Airport to Vermont?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Orlando Airport to Vermont,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Orlando Airport to Vermont, you should book around 2 weeks before departure, which saves you about 23%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 19 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Orlando to Vermont?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Orlando to Vermont with an airline and back with another airline.
